Frequently Asked Questions
What are the average rental prices for parking spaces in Caloundra?
In Caloundra, you can expect to pay around $400 per month for a parking space. Some options may be available for less, with prices starting from approximately $35 per week for smaller lots. For those looking for long-term rentals, platforms like Parkhound offer monthly rates starting from $533.00 in the Sunshine Coast region.
Which platforms are best for renting parking spaces in Caloundra?
For renting parking spaces in Caloundra, consider using platforms like Parkhound and Spacer. These websites offer a variety of listings, including garages and outdoor spots, making it easy to find a suitable option near local landmarks like Caloundra’s shopping centres and beaches. You can also check community boards for local rentals.
What are typical lease terms for parking rentals in Caloundra?
In Caloundra, most parking leases require a minimum commitment of three months. For instance, some listings necessitate a bond of $400 in addition to the first month’s rent. It’s essential to read the terms carefully, especially if you are renting a space with additional amenities, such as those found near the Sunshine Coast caravan parks.
